Ominous premonitions often turned into reality …
When Feng Bujue came to the wall with anticipation, and when he saw the plastic drawing board on the wall, the first 'nasty puzzle' finally appeared.
It turned out that the "map" on the drawing board was not arranged in an orderly manner. Other than the title at the top, "Cedar County Public Hospital 2F Floor Map", the rest of the content was a mess. The drawings were not right, the words were not right, it looked like … a big jigsaw puzzle that was misplaced.
"Oh … Is this a test of the player's memory ability?" Feng Bujue looked at the messy diagram and mumbled to himself, "Puzzles are my specialty …" As he said that, he steadied himself. His left hand held his right elbow, and his right hand held his chin. His eyes glowed like a torch as he started the mental puzzle.
Five minutes passed without him noticing …
Feng Bujue still stood in the same position and mumbled, "Hmm … This is much more complicated than I thought …"
After careful observation, he realized that the "puzzle pieces" on the drawing board were all irregular shapes. There were about twenty of these patterns mixed together and dislocated to form the "map" in front of him.
This was much more difficult than the usual rectangular or zigzag puzzles. It was already difficult for the human brain to memorize so many diagrams in such a short period of time. The difficulty of arranging these diagrams in one's mind was self-evident.
"Looks like it's going to take a lot of time …" Brother Bujue mumbled.
Bang, bang …
Then, there was another change.
There was a series of powerful footsteps coming from behind him, gradually approaching.
"Hmm? Is that bandage guy here again … "Feng Bujue mumbled and slowly turned around. At the same time, his hand reached into his pocket to take out his sunglasses.
Unexpectedly, this time, he saw something else …
He saw a burly figure slowly walking toward him. The monster had a sarcoma-like head and was almost three meters tall. The top of its head was almost touching the ceiling, and the muscles on its body were bulging …
"F * ck …" Feng Bujue saw the monster and was shocked.
"Lester! You bastard! " On the monster's wart-like head, there was a crack that looked like a mouth. There were two rows of sharp teeth in the crack. It was using this' mouth 'to roar, "I'm going to kill you!"
"Hmm …" Feng Bujue put on his sunglasses and glanced at the man. Then, he quickly took them off because he realized that it was the same when he looked at the man with his naked eyes. "What's going on … I didn't set up any flags …" The man's movement speed was not too fast, and he was still quite far away, so Feng Bujue was not in a hurry to escape. "Oh … I understand." He seemed to have thought of something. "Have I stayed in the same place for too long …?"
This analysis was not without reason because the main mission of the scenario was' Stay at your post and survive until dawn '. Therefore, theoretically speaking … as long as the players did not leave the hospital and ensured that they would not die, they could do anything. Even if Feng Bujue simply squatted in a corner without any monsters and did not explore, he would not be judged to be playing AFK-like.
"Hint: If you stay in the corridor for too long, the angry worker, Chad, will appear. The powerful Chad can easily tear you into pieces, so you need to escape as soon as possible. You can escape from Chad's pursuit by entering a room. Chad will linger at the door of the room for one minute before leaving. "
The system notification entered his ears and supported his analysis.
"Then, this is strange … The puzzle of this' map 'is not something that can be solved in a short period of time, right?" Feng Bujue thought about it as he turned around and walked to the left side of the T-junction. "Do I need to find a disposable camera to snap a picture of the map on this board and then tear the picture into pieces to solve the puzzle?"
Feng Bujue had a bit of an obsessive-compulsive disorder. If he was asked to give up on a half-solved puzzle, he would feel uncomfortable all over. But since there was a monster that he had to kill, he had no choice but to run.
"Hey! Chad! " When Feng Bujue was running, he did not forget to turn back to chat with the worker who moved at a normal speed. "What kind of grudge do we have? Why do you have to do this? "
"You slept with my sister!" Chad roared.
"Hmm … You give me a reason that makes me speechless …" Feng Bujue grumbled. Then he turned back to yell, "I believe there must be a misunderstanding! Perhaps we are in love! "
Before he could finish, the tendons on the side of Chad's neck suddenly grew. As a ball of pus exploded, a second head popped out from the side of his neck. It was also a blob of flesh with a blurry face, but it was a woman's voice. "Lester! You b * stard! You said you would call me! "
"Hint: You have angered Chad and activated his sister's vengeful spirit. From now on, his power will be further enhanced."
Before the system notification ended, the 'twin-headed giant' picked up its pace.
This time … Brother Jue was not going to run so leisurely anymore. He sprinted and started to search for the door closest to him.
"This flag came out of nowhere!" Feng Bujue grumbled. "Singing Huo Yuanjia can chase the monster away, but negotiating with it will only worsen the situation!"
Soon, he was close to the door of a consultation room. He did not have time to think about it. He ran to the door and grabbed the doorknob to turn it. Then … the most classic system notification appeared, "Cannot be opened."
"What the f * ck!" Feng Bujue yelled as he stood up and started running again.
In the few seconds of delay, Chad got even closer. This meant that Brother Jue could not stop to try other doors. He could only try to put some distance between them … or else he would be attacked the moment he stopped to open the door.
"I knew I couldn't be careless …" Feng Bujue thought to himself. "If I had known this would happen … I would have turned and run the moment I saw him."
At that moment, his recent experience in real life came into play. After Feng Bujue got serious, he quickly adjusted his breathing, footsteps, and running posture. Once again, he shook off his pursuer.
However, at this delicate moment, another absurd scene appeared in front of him.
At the end of the corridor, there was a staircase. The staircase did not go up or down. Instead, it was connected to the wall on the right and extended to the side.
"What the hell …" Feng Bujue's eyes widened.
Since he would die if he stopped, he had no time to think. He could only grit his teeth and continue.
In the end … he managed to run up the staircase that extended to the side.
When Brother Jue put his foot on the staircase, he felt the gravity of the area in front of him shift. At that moment, his mind buzzed and he figured it out. "The map is correct!"
